Stephan Aßmus
57e2488804 Get rid of special B_OP_COPY implementation for rendering text
Since BeOS had no anti-aliased drawing except for text, it didn't
matter whether drawing diagonal lines (for example) in B_OP_COPY
or B_OP_OVER. Applying the meaning of B_OP_COPY strictly to everything
else would have broken pretty much every existing BeOS, resulting
in broken drawing for anything but straight lines and rectangles.
The solution was to treat B_OP_COPY just like B_OP_OVER *except*
for text rendering, where we could be compatible with the BeOS
behavior. Nevertheless, one can sometimes observe apps using B_OP_COPY
where they /should/ be using B_OP_OVER for rendering text, resulting
in white edges around the glyphs where the actual LowColor() does not
match the current background on which the text is rendered.
There is however a problem when glyphs in a string overlap. Some
fonts have overlapping glyphs by default (handwriting, etc). With
the LCD sub-pixel filtering, this problem is visible even in fonts
where glyphs don't overlap normally, for example 'lt'. The leftmost
pixel of the 't' is smeared due to the filtering and produces an
almost transparent pixel which is rendered (using the low color as
the background) on top of the 'l'. To fix this, one would have to
render the string into an alpha mask buffer first, and then blend it
all at once using B_OP_COPY. This however defeats the point of
B_OP_COPY, which is to be a performance optimization. So instead, I
opted for the solution that is already in place for everything else,
which is to make B_OP_COPY behave like B_OP_OVER. For the case that
this would have produced a difference, i.e. rendering with the solid
high color, one needs to clear the background using the low color,
before rendering text, or it would have looked broken. So in practice,
there cannot be a difference.

Stephan Aßmus
54333f5172 Don't do LCD subpixel filtering twice
The currently included version of libfreetype already has the LCD
subpixel filter turned on by default. With the switch from my
"averaging filter" back to Adrej Spielmann's filtering, there was now
another filtering being done on top of what Freetype already does.
There also seemed to be a problem with the left edge of cached
glyph bitmaps, which I didn't bother to look into. The visual result
of this change is that text looks much crisper, and the display
bugs at touching glyphs is gone.

On the other hand, LCD sub-pixel rendering is still turned on
globally, i.e. for all vector drawing, and for uncached rotated
text. The Freetype filtering is not applied there. This problem did
not exist in my "average filter", since it happened at the scanline
rendering level, not only for cached glyph bitmaps. It is however
not a regression introduced by this commit. It needs to be fixed
separately.

Stephan Aßmus
954a0a0c33 Fix some cases of updating draw state while recording a BPicture
* Also implemented recording DrawString(string, length,
   BPoint[] locations), which was previously not recorded at all.
 * Also implemented playing back recently added drawing commands
   in PicturePlayer.cpp. I don't quite understand what this is
   actually used for, but it seemed it was forgotten. I just followed
   the pattern already established in the code.
 * The other important bit in this change is to update the pen
   location when it is needed while recording a BPicture. Often
   the BView will use PenLocation() in order to transmit drawing
   commands to the app_server which use absolute coordinates only.
   This isn't actually so nice, since it means the client has to
   wait for the server to transmit the current pen location. If there
   were dedicated link-commands for pen-relative drawing commands,
   the client could just keep sending without waiting for the server.
   In any case, the app_server needs to update the pen location in
   the current DrawState and even the DrawingEngine even while
   recording a picture, because some next command may need up-2-date
   state information, such as the font state and the pen location.
 * I have not yet tried to find /all/ instances where the DrawState
   needs to be updated while recording. This change should repair
   /all/ font state changes, all versions of drawing a string, and
   all versions of StrokeLine().

Stephan Aßmus
f8550e541b Added two DrawStringDry() versions for obtaining pen location only
When recording into a BPicture (ServerPicture, actually), one cannot
simply record the commands only, when the drawing itself would modify
state. This affects all drawing commands that change the pen location.
Therefore it is necessary to have a way to "dry-run" drawing a string
in order to know the pen location that would result. This is what
these two new methods help achieve.

Michael Lotz
64a11edb02 app_server: Make more use of BStackOrHeapArray.
Variable length arrays on the stack are always risky when the length
is indeterminate as they can easily overflow the stack. Replace their
use by BStackOrHeapArray, fixes #6354.

Also replace most other dynamic allocations by BStackOrHeapArray as
it is more convenient and may avoid unnecessary dynamic allocations.

Add allocation checks and early returns to all places while at it.

Danc2
def61273ed net_server: Add (more) missing devices even if one has already been found.
Fixes #6423 and helps with #14626.

In BringUpInterfaces, line 772 creates an error which only adds a missing
interface if one does not already exist (i.e., !_testInterface()). This can lead to
a missing WiFi interface if an Ethernet connection has been configured and set in
the /boot/system/settings/network/interfaces before the WiFi has had a chance to
be added to /dev/net. To properly configure a missing device, such as a WiFi
connection, and allow the user to choose amongst configured interfaces (i.e.,
add it to the list of devices in /dev/net and e.g., see WiFi as an option),
removing the 'if' statement on line 772 is necessary.

Two edge cases may arise:
1. A user may disable an interface -- don't add device
Solution: The code currently handles this. _ConfigureInterfacesFromSettings, called
at line 746, checks for interfaces in fSettings to see if they are disabled (706-711).
If so, they are disabled and not set as a missingDevice if the interface is disabled
(709). The next interface is checked... etc.

2. Devices must not be added twice (i.e., Checking for An Existing configured Network)
Solution: The code currently checks for this. On lines 716-720, a device that is found
in fSettings (missingDevice), is set to the interface which is later added to the
/dev/net within that (unnecessary?) if statement (772). The missingDevice will only
be set and added to /dev/net if an entry does not exist in the settings already (716)
(hence the identifier missingDevice).

Augustin Cavalier
7457ccb4b2 BMessageFormat: Rename to BStringFormat.
The ICU class is named MessageFormat, but on Haiku, it sounds too much
like something related to BMessage (which it isn't in the slightest)
and not part of the Locale system. It works almost entirely with BStrings,
so naming it BStringFormat makes much more sense.
